The phrase "allowed the acquisition of"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used in contexts where permission or approval is given for someone or something to obtain or gain possession of something else.
Example: "The board of directors allowed the acquisition of the smaller company to expand their market reach."
Alternatives: "permitted the purchase of" or "authorized the takeover of".
